Hi Willy1962,
I'll let you into a little secret of mine...If you place the Mack Mod above the Kenworths and other trucks in the Mod Manager you can put the Mack wheels onto the Kenworths.
What you need to do in order for it to work is first select the tyre on the Kenworth in the Upgrades Shop/Showroom and choose the "RTA Continental" tyres from the top of the list. When you do this the existing wheel on the truck will disappear but if you select the wheel hookup point now you will have the options to put the Mack wheels, hub-covers and wheel nuts onto the Kenworths (and other trucks)
Also I found that the T609 needs to be below the trucks you want to put the Mack wheels onto in the Mod Manager load order, otherwise the centre hubs of the Mack wheels will be replaced by the centre hub of the T609, which can be handy if you want to change things up a bit more.
